Short North

Colorful, offbeat, and trendy, this densely-populated district offers art galleries, specialty shops, pubs, nightclubs, and coffee shops. Stroll along High Street under its 17 lighted metal arches, and admire the vibrant murals on its brick buildings.

German Village

Step back in time along the brick-lined streets of German Village in Columbus. This beautifully preserved 19th-century neighborhood showcases distinctive architecture and strong European heritage. The cobblestone pathways lead visitors past charming cottages and flowering gardens. The Book Loft's 32 rooms of literary treasures delight bibliophiles. Schiller Park serves as a green oasis with its amphitheater hosting German festivals throughout the year. Authentic German restaurants fill the air with tempting aromas while local boutiques offer artisanal goods.

Downtown Columbus

Enjoy entertainment options like theaters, concerts, and the Scioto Mile's riverfront parks in this central business district with towering buildings and various educational institutions.

Arena District

The Arena District pulses with energy as Columbus's premier entertainment hub. Hockey fans flock to Nationwide Arena for Blue Jackets games while concert-goers head to KEMBA Live! for shows. Sleek glass towers and converted brick buildings create a modern urban landscape perfect for night owls and sports enthusiasts. During game nights, sports bars and upscale restaurants buzz with excited crowds. The North Market offers local flavors just steps from luxury apartments and business hotels. Perfectly walkable and centrally located, this neighborhood puts you right where the action happens in downtown Columbus.

University District

Home to Ohio State University, the University District boasts a diverse range of restaurants, bars, boutiques, and the Gateway Film Center. Explore Ohio Stadium and Old North Columbus for a taste of local culture.

Best time to go to Columbus

The best time to visit Columbus is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January28.6°F (-1.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February31.5°F (-0.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March41.7°F (5.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April52.0°F (11.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May63.1°F (17.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
June70.9°F (21.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July74.7°F (23.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August73.0°F (22.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
September67.3°F (19.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
November43.2°F (6.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December35.4°F (1.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Columbus

Flying into Columbus, Ohio is convenient with the main airport being Columbus, OH (CMH-John Glenn Columbus Intl.), situated 11km from downtown. Excellent hotel options nearby include the 4.5-star Hotel LeVeque and the 4-star Sonesta Columbus Downtown, both within 11km of the airport. Alternatively, you can fly into Dayton, OH (DAY-James M. Cox Dayton Intl.), which is 105km away, with nearby hotels like the 3.5-star Wingate by Wyndham Dayton North. Lastly, Akron, OH (CAK-Akron-Canton) is 169km from Columbus, offering the 4-star DoubleTree by Hilton Canton Downtown among its accommodations. All these airports provide accessible transportation options to their respective hotels.

What's the weather like in Columbus?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 71°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 34°F. Average annual precipitation for Columbus is 49 inches.
